In drag racing you want a clutch that will:

a) Hold high power
b) Not get glazed surfaces, lowering coefficient of friction
b) Allow you to slip it as much as humanly possible

Multi plates are very high clamp load pressure plates with a larger contact surface area to soak up more torque, meaning they are more slippable yet hold higher power as the friction material is very grabby and the pressure plate is stiff.
